Hot Green Beans Vinaigrette

0
(0)
CATEGORY CUISINE TAG YIELD
Vegetables, Grains Vegetable 4 Servings

INGREDIENTS

1 lb Fresh green beans
2 c Water
1/2 ts Salt
2 tb Extra-virgin olive oil
1 tb Wine vinegar
1 tb Jalapeno Jelly (see index) or use purchased hot or mild Jalapeno Jelly
1 ts Fresh lime juice

INSTRUCTIONS

Snap ends of beans; leave beans whole. In a saucepan, bring water & salt to
a boil; add beans, cover & cook 5 minutes or until brighter in color &
tender-crisp to bite. Drain, then immediately add oil, vinegar, jelly &
lime juice. Stir to coat, then serve. Makes 4 servings.
